In speaking with The Takedown On SI, WWE Superstar Logan Paul, who is scheduled to be part of the Fanatics Flag Football Classic in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ia on March 21, 2026, gave his thoughts on how most NFL players would do inside a WWE wrestling ring, saying they would not be able to handle it and that 99 percent of them would “s—- the bed.
“If you put any of the WWE Superstars on the roster, including the women, on an NFL team, they would do bare minimum, all right, because these people are athletes,” Paul continued. “If you plucked 99 percent of NFL athletes from the team and put them in a WWE ring, they would s— the bed. They would not be able to do it. It is the hardest thing in the world to do.”
The Fanatics Flag Football Classic is a formatted three-team tournament. The event is scheduled to air on FOX Sports and Tubi and will be hosted by comedian Kevin Hart.
Paul is a former WWE United States Champion and is a current member of The Vision, which is part of the Raw roster.
